The Silberstein Family
The Silberstein Family is a private foundation focused on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king, based in PALM BEACH GARDENS, FL.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2025. As of 2025, the organization holds $165K in total assets. In 2025, it awarded 13 grants totaling $9K.

How much is The Silberstein Family required to give away each year?
Private foundations must generally distribute about 5% of their assets annually. For 2025, The Silberstein Family reported a distributable amount of $8K on its IRS Form 990-PF — the minimum it must pay out in qualifying distributions.
